Bradley D Patterson is a notable inventor based in Dunkirk, Indiana, known for his contributions to the field of combustion technology. He holds a total of 4 patents, showcasing his innovative approach to engineering solutions.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is a fuel-fired burner with internal exhaust gas recycle. This invention includes a combustion air inlet for receiving combustion air, which is coupled to a combustion air nozzle at an input to a second chamber within a burner housing. This chamber is spaced apart from a third chamber within the second chamber. The combustion air nozzle directs the combustion air into the third chamber. A fuel inlet is coupled to a burner nozzle secured to a burner mounting plate, which has a recycle port for receiving hot exhaust gas provided to an exhaust gas path. A jet pump located entirely inside the burner housing is configured to receive the hot exhaust gas from the exhaust gas path. The jet pump operates by flowing the combustion air through the combustion air nozzle, which suctions in the hot exhaust gas through the recycle port into the exhaust gas path, then into a gas mixing zone for mixing the hot exhaust gas and the combustion air.
